Solution for 3(2x)+4(6)-6x=-2(2x+2)+4 equation:


Simplifying
3(2x) + 4(6) + -6x = -2(2x + 2) + 4

Remove parenthesis around (2x)
3 * 2x + 4(6) + -6x = -2(2x + 2) + 4

Multiply 3 * 2
6x + 4(6) + -6x = -2(2x + 2) + 4

Multiply 4 * 6
6x + 24 + -6x = -2(2x + 2) + 4

Reorder the terms:
24 + 6x + -6x = -2(2x + 2) + 4

Combine like terms: 6x + -6x = 0
24 + 0 = -2(2x + 2) + 4
24 = -2(2x + 2) + 4

Reorder the terms:
24 = -2(2 + 2x) + 4
24 = (2 * -2 + 2x * -2) + 4
24 = (-4 + -4x) + 4

Reorder the terms:
24 = -4 + 4 + -4x

Combine like terms: -4 + 4 = 0
24 = 0 + -4x
24 = -4x

Solving
24 = -4x

Solving for variable 'x'.

Move all terms containing x to the left, all other terms to the right.

Add '4x' to each side of the equation.
24 + 4x = -4x + 4x

Combine like terms: -4x + 4x = 0
24 + 4x = 0

Add '-24' to each side of the equation.
24 + -24 + 4x = 0 + -24

Combine like terms: 24 + -24 = 0
0 + 4x = 0 + -24
4x = 0 + -24

Combine like terms: 0 + -24 = -24
4x = -24

Divide each side by '4'.
x = -6

Simplifying
x = -6
